    What is SEO, and Why Do You Need It?

    SEO is a process focused on organic search engine results. Through SEO, both creative and technical elements are utilized in order to increase traffic, awareness, and improve rankings within the search engine.

    The Benefits of SEO

    When used correctly, SEO can assist in placing your website at the top of the search engine results when people look up your type of products or services. There are two key components in improving your ranking: ensuring that the keywords to locate your website are on the website itself, and having other quality websites link directly to your website.

    Optimize Content for SEO

    Content that does not provide properly formatted text will often be completely ignored or undervalued by the search engine scan. The most common places to add content to ensure SEO works at its best include alt text for images, supplemental search boxes, and meta information. Tools like Google’s Cache can assist you in viewing what elements are visible to the search engine.
